AUSSIE BONDS
AUSSIE BONDS: Bond futures continue to operate in a tight range, with little in
the way of catalysts on the horizon, as Japan observes a market holiday and the
U.S. observes a shortened session.
- 3-/10-Year cash curve holding sub-60.0bp for the time being.
- Bills unchanged to 1 tick lower last on low volume.
